The revolution that won Coyote's independence from Earth's government is twenty years in the past. Large areas of the planet remain unexplored. Coyote's aging computers, aircraft, and medical equipment are badly in need of replacement. And the colony's survival is in question.Hope arrives in the form of the European Alliance starship Columbus, delivering a starbridge - an invention that allows almost instantaneous travel between Earth and Coyote. With Earth in ruins, humankind needs a new home - and Coyote is its last, best refuge. But this technology may prove to be more of a detriment than a boon. Now the colony's hard-won independence depends on the descendants of Coyote's original settlers - and those who have their own agendas for its future.Former freedom fighter Carlos Montero, now in his fifties and burdened with the responsibilities of leadership. Manuel Castro, the savant and former lieutenant governor of New Florida, now a hermit who may hold the key to the survival of those whose company he has renounced. Jonas Whittaker, the genius inventor haunted by the loss of the wife and daughter he sacrificed to save his own life. And Morgan Goldstein, an entrepreneur seeking to exploit Coyote's natural resources - even if it means ruining the planet itself.As Coyote's future hangs in the balance, a larger question looms: Can the human race settle a new world without bringing forward the problems of the world it left behind?
